Commercial Slab Installation in Littleton, CO
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ete foundations for a variety of property projects, including parking lots, warehouse floors, retail spaces, and other large-scale surfaces. These services are essential for creating durable, level, and stable surfaces that can support heavy equipment, vehicles, and foot traffic. Property owners typically seek this service when constructing new commercial buildings or upgrading existing structures to ensure a solid foundation that meets safety and usability standards.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ners should consider factors such as the size and layout of the area, soil conditions, drainage requirements, and any necessary permits or regulations. Understanding the intended use of the space and the load-bearing needs can help determine the appropriate thickness and reinforcement for the slab. Clear communication about project specifications and site conditions can contribute to a smooth installation process and a long-lasting finished surface.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require commercial slab installation? Commercial slab installation is often used for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or work areas on commercial properties.
What materials are typically used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the most common material, chosen for its durability and ability to support heavy loads in commercial settings.
Are there specific considerations for preparing a site for commercial slabs? Proper site preparation includes soil testing, grading, and ensuring a stable base to support the slab and prevent cracking.
How does the size of the project impact the installation process? Larger projects may require additional planning for reinforcement, joints, and curing to ensure the slab's strength and longevity.
